MERIDIAN, Miss. (WTOK) – Friday is the last day of Women’s History Month. During this time, the local DJ has made it his mission to respect women in our society.
Joyce Franklin, host of Morning Praise Tour with Joyce, started the tradition of honoring women during Women’s History Month four years ago. This year was no different.
“March is Women’s History Month and I chose to honor some women, local women in the area who are movers, shakers, social women, hardworking women who are dedicated to family and community,” Franklin said. “Local women who have just built themselves and built their community and are trying to do something for the community.
